Output cf590036a4f75d076bcf72d02705a70d53b731bfcc68a8fbea40d2942b81aa29:22

value
14817452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4419078efa803ce49ade9981628015795cbb26db OP_EQUAL
address
37u5rfpbVHMxyFg95hxazNfKApteLBNaEm
transaction
cf590036a4f75d076bcf72d02705a70d53b731bfcc68a8fbea40d2942b81aa29
spent
true